Mesothelioma is a fatal type of cancer that affects the respiratory tract. It's caused by exposure asbestos, which was utilized in many different occupations and consumer products. The mesothelioma lawsuits seek financial compensation from asbestos-related companies that exposed individuals to toxic substances.

A select few mesothelioma lawsuits go to trial. Most are settled outside of court. A reputable law firm will be prepared to take your case to trial when it's in the best interest of the patient.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can help you determine the time and place you were exposed to asbestos, even if you don't remember. They will look over documents from companies and other sources to determine which corporations should be held accountable for the condition you're suffering from.

They may also file a wrongful-death claim on behalf of you in the event you've lost someone you love because of an asbestos-related illness. A mesothelioma wrongful death lawsuit may claim compensation for funeral expenses as well as loss of companionship, and other things.

Mesothelioma is a rare and deadly form of cancer that occurs when an individual is exposed to asbestos. This asbestos exposure is typically in a workplace where workers handled asbestos-containing products. The cancer could develop anywhere from 10 to 40 years after exposure, and may be a threat to lungs as well as the heart, abdomen, and other organs. Mesothelioma patients are entitled to compensation from asbestos companies accountable for their exposure. Compensation can be sought through filing a lawsuit or seeking compensation through the asbestos trust fund.
